The Executive Development Programme in Ethics & the Future of Space is a certificate course designed to address the growing demand for ethical leadership in the space industry. This programme emphasizes the importance of ethical decision-making, responsible innovation, and long-term sustainability in space exploration and exploitation.

As space technologies continue to advance and commercial ventures become more prevalent, the need for professionals who can navigate complex ethical challenges becomes increasingly critical. This course equips learners with essential skills in ethical leadership, policy development, and strategic planning for the future of space. By completing this programme, learners will be better positioned to advance their careers in the space industry, as employers seek out professionals who can demonstrate a strong understanding of ethical considerations and the ability to lead in a rapidly evolving field.
